Transaction 33bfde1b9524db79b19bc83ab262c3f0d93a995e71f4d2bc09a228404ad13cb2

1 Input
2 Outputs
  • 33bfde1b9524db79b19bc83ab262c3f0d93a995e71f4d2bc09a228404ad13cb2:0
  • value  22107914
    address  1CyeYQ2zuknNLvSfHApNjg4DXRsKvmzhMw
  • 33bfde1b9524db79b19bc83ab262c3f0d93a995e71f4d2bc09a228404ad13cb2:1
  • value  1438600
    address  16RQB21zsQxiiJuT1Z8XCByHGXjFH4JyN7